NullAsValue
L'istruzione NullAsValue specifica per quali campi NULL deve essere convertito in un valore.
Sintassi:
NullAsValue *fieldlist
Per impostazione predefinita, QlikView considera i valori NULL come entità mancati o non definite. Tuttavia, alcuni database considerano i valori NULL valori speciali piuttosto che semplici valori mancanti. È possibile sospendere il divieto di collegamento reciproco dei valori NULL con altri valori NULL mediante l’istruzione NullAsValue.
L'istruzione NullAsValue funge da interruttore e viene applicata alle istruzioni di caricamento successive. Questa istruzione può essere disattivata di nuovo utilizzando l'istruzione NullAsNull.
Argomenti:
Argomento | Descrizione |
---|---|
*fieldlist | Un elenco separato da virgole dei campi per il quale è necessario attivare l'istruzione NullAsValue. L'utilizzo di * per l'elenco dei campi indica tutti i campi. Nei nomi di campo sono consentiti i caratteri speciali * e ?. Se si utilizzano i caratteri speciali può essere necessario delimitare i nomi di campo tra virgolette. |
Esempio:
NullAsValue A,B;
Set NullValue = 'NULL';
LOAD A,B from x.csv;